What is the purpose of this construction project? This is an improvement project to replace and increase the capacity of the existing sanitary sewer line in areas on Calamo Street and Spring Road. There is a second phase of the project that is outside the roadway and in the neighboring woods.
What is the estimated timeframe for completion of this construction project? All construction and repaving is anticipated to be complete by the end of October 2026.
What are the expected construction hours? Construction hours will vary depending on weather, holiday schedules, lane closure hour restrictions, and construction phasing. It should be expected that construction activity will generally occur between 7 am and 5 pm on Monday-Friday. No night work is planned at this time.
What is a continuous detour and how will it help with this project? A continuous detour will be in place continuously for 24 hours a day/7 days a week. The continuous closure will allow us to expedite the project completion.
Will my driveway be repaved? Any paved driveway areas that were disturbed during construction will be repaved when all work is complete.
How will access to my property be maintained during the continuous detour? Residents and emergency services will always have access to their property. We will continue coordinating with property owners to ensure safe and continuous access to their property. Emergency vehicle access has been planned for and we are working with Fairfax County Fire and Rescue, the local Fire Department, and Local/State Police to make sure they can reach your property in the event of an emergency.
Will there be any restrictions on street parking due to construction? Currently there is no street parking and there will not be any street parking allowed in or around the construction area.

Will my trash and mail services be impacted? We will be in regular contact with Republic Services, Evergreen Disposal, Bates Disposal and US Postal Services to ensure their services are not disrupted.
